[Bug 1435179] [NEW] kdesudo (vivid): Could not connect to display

2015-03-23 Thread themroc
Public bug reported:

kdesudo don't work anymore in Kubuntu Vivid:

~$ kdesudo kate
Bus::open: Can not get ibus-daemon's address. 
IBusInputContext::createInputContext: no connection to ibus-daemon 
QXcbConnection: Could not connect to display 

---

lsb_release -rd:
Description:Ubuntu Vivid Vervet (development branch)
Release:15.04

apt-cache policy kdesudo:
kdesudo:
  Installiert:   3.4.2.4+repack-2ubuntu4
  Installationskandidat: 3.4.2.4+repack-2ubuntu4
  Versionstabelle:
 *** 3.4.2.4+repack-2ubuntu4 0
500 http://de.archive.ubuntu.com/ubuntu/ vivid/universe amd64 Packages
100 /var/lib/dpkg/status

[Bug 1435161] [NEW] Login screen does not re-appear after KDE logout

2015-03-23 Thread Launchpad Bug Tracker
You have been subscribed to a public bug:

Running Kubuntu 15.04. nightly build as at 21 Mar 2015
Using KDE start menu to logoff
After logoff the logon screen does not appear (black screen, still in X, since 
mouse arrow cursor visible and can be moved around)
Need to reboot
